Travel brings numerous rewards. I encourage people to find a way to make travel a part of their life. If you have to give something else up to accomplish it, do it. Here are some reasons why:
1. It creates lifelong memories. I have stood in front of the Mona Lisa and Michangelo’s David. I have walked the streets of Pompeii and Assisi. I have ridden horses over Roman bridges and the Serengeti. I have skied down an Austrian glacier and the Colorado Rockies. I have seen endless wildlife in its natural habitat. These memories I will dream of for a life time.
Africa
2. Travel leads to learning. You can read about a culture, nature or art in a book, but it is never the same as experiencing it firsthand.
3. You will become better rounded. Travel will open your mind to other ways of thinking. Because things will be done differently than you are used to, you will have to adapt. This may open your mind to a new food, a new thought process or a new design.
Spain
4. Adventure builds confidence. Doing things you have never done before is exciting. Realizing that you can hike up a mountain trail, try a new food, ride trains you have never been on before helps you step up to new challenges elsewhere.
Hong Kong
5. Improves problem solving skills. When on the road in strange places you will have to find new ways of doing things. Perhaps you have never ridden a subway in DC. You will figure it out once you are there.
6. Improves communication skills. No matter whether you travel internationally or to the other side of the country, the culture will be different than your hometown. If you communicate with the locals they may do it a little differently than you. You will find new ways to communicate and to understand others.
7. Improves your creativity. When I travel, I enjoy looking at different architecture, interior design, graphic design, packaging design, etc. Even airports have a design flair that is fun to take in and observe.
I travel to learn and grow, to expand my horizons, to look at things from different angles, to appreciate home, to rest my mind from daily life, to add magic to existence, to challenge myself, to improve skills, to have romance, to read poetry, to foster appreciation of new things, and so much more.
